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A persistent musty smell is often a sign that your pipes have corroded, causing a slow leak. Don’t ignore this sign as it can lead to mold growth and bacteria contamination.
Water Stains on Ceilings and Walls
Floors and walls with water stains are a clear indication that you have a leak somewhere. Don’t wait to investigate further, as this can lead to costly repairs and potential health hazards.
Increased Water Bills
A sudden increase in your water bills can be a sign that your pipes are leaking, wasting precious water and resources. Check your meter and investigate further to prevent costly repairs.
Cracks and Warping in Flooring and Walls
Cracks and warping in your flooring and walls can be a sign of water damage from corroded pipes. Don’t ignore this sign as it can lead to costly repairs and potential health hazards.
Visible Signs of Leaks in Basements and Crawlspaces
Visible signs of leaks in your basement or crawlspace are a clear indication that you have a problem. Don’t ignore this sign as it can lead to costly repairs and potential health hazards.

Corroded Pipe Water Removal Cost in King, NC
The cost of Corroded Pipe Water Removal varies based on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ions in King, NC. These are estimates, not guarantees. Get a free estimate to find out the exact cost of your project.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Containment | $500 – $2,500 | Severity of damage and size of affected area |
| Water Removal and Drying | $2,000 – $10,000 | Size of affected area and amount of water |
| Sanitizing and Dehumidifying |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area and extent of contamination |
| Final Inspection and Touch-ups |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area and extent of remaining issues |
| More Services (e.g., mold remediation) | $1,000 – $5,000 | Severity of contamination and extent of affected area |
